AGARTALA, Dec 18 (TIWN): Tripura Chief Minister Manik Sarkar at Assembly Winter Session said that the black-money curbing was a show off led by the Modi Govt to hide the failure of tracking ‘black-money’, which he promised to bring back from abroad.
‘If they are tracking black money then they should publish the black-money holders name…. where is the list? Show us’, Sarkar said in the Assembly.
“Stop fooling people in the name of black-money curbing. Due to shortage of notes the common people had suffered a lot, many lost their lives”, Sarkar added.
“Let the old notes run till 30th December or till the cash crisis doesn’t end”, he added.
Sarkar said: "According to the World Bank estimates, in India the volume of black money -- comprising gold, silver, diamond, real estate, share market and hundi, among others -- is over Rs 37.5 lakh crore. And only five per cent of it is in cash."
"So, how can demonetisation of high-value currency notes curb black money?"
